| Abstract: | The Section 809 Panel's third report on acquisition reform contains a variety of useful recommendations, industry groups say. Some of the most important include enacting regular appropriations bills, providing advance payments to small businesses and improving DOD-industry communication. One group questioned the panel's approach to commercial item acquisition reform. |
